Parascapular free flaps in skin malignancies.
Kristin Kucera Marcum1, J Dale Browne
1Department of Otolaryngology, Wake Forest Baptist Medical Center, Winston-Salem, North Carolina, USA. kmarcum@wfubmc.edu
Parascapular fasciocutaneous free flaps are a safe and effective option for reconstructing head and neck skin cancer defects. Using this method for cutaneous squamous cell carcinoma (SCC) reconstruction offers cosmetic benefits and avoids donor site malignancies.

Background:
- Cutaneous squamous cell carcinoma (SCC) of the head and neck often requires surgical resection, leading to complex defects.
- Reconstruction of these defects is crucial for functional and aesthetic outcomes.
- The selection of appropriate donor tissue is vital to minimize morbidity and prevent secondary malignancies.
Observation:
- A retrospective review of nine patients (aged 40-83) with head and neck cutaneous SCC undergoing reconstruction after surgical resection was conducted.
- Parascapular fasciocutaneous free flaps were utilized for defect reconstruction in these patients.
- The study evaluated the safety, reliability, and cosmetic effectiveness of this reconstructive technique.
Findings:
- Parascapular fasciocutaneous free flaps demonstrated to be a safe, reliable, and cosmetically effective method for reconstructing head and neck skin cancer defects.
- Utilizing donor tissue from non-sun-exposed areas, such as the parascapular region, can prevent the development of new malignancies at the donor site.
- The versatility of the parascapular fasciocutaneous free flap was highlighted in addressing complex surgical defects.
Implications:
- The parascapular fasciocutaneous free flap is a valuable reconstructive option for head and neck cutaneous SCC, offering excellent functional and aesthetic results.
- This technique minimizes the risk of secondary skin cancers at the donor site, a significant advantage over sun-exposed donor tissues.
- The findings support the broader application of parascapular fasciocutaneous free flaps in managing complex head and neck reconstructions.
